Fred 1 575 Signaler ce message Posté(e) 11 juin 2019 Abonnez-vous pour être notifié de la sortie d'une nouvelle version de ZwiiCMS Pour les échanges sur la version sortie, merci d'ouvrir un fil de discussion en ajoutant le numéro de version entre crochets. 2 3 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 15 juin 2019 ZwiiCMS 9.1.10 est disponible : - Améliorations : - Page sitemap et sitemap.xml : les articles de blog avec le statut brouillon sont masqués. - Sitemap.xml : ajout de la date de publication des articles. - Réseau social : Github. - Correction : - Suppression du ? dans les URLs vers les fichiers sitemap de robots.txt 2 1 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 16 juin 2019 il y a 8 minutes, Fred a dit : ZwiiCMS 9.1.11 est disponible. Bug remonté par @Gilux ce matin qui bizarrement ne touchait que lui : une petite erreur de syntaxe lors de la création du sitemap.xml : un objet timezone transmit à la place d'un paramètre de type string... forcément. Voilà bien à quoi sert ce forum, merci à lui pour ce retour d''expérience. https://zwiicms.com/public/archive/ZwiiCMS-9111.zip 1 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 19 juin 2019 ZwiiCMS 9.1.12 est dispo. Deux corrections, proposées par @Eric et @Gilux ## Version 9.1.12 - Amélioration : - Contrôle d'erreur dans la gestion de l'imagette OpenGraph - Correction: - Sitemap.xml : prendre en compte les sous-pages d'une page parente masquée - Free affichait une erreur lors de la connexion au service Google -> erreur est maintenant gérée - Le sitemap.xml est amélioré. 9.1.13 se prépare, au programme, la possibilité de disposer de 1, 2 ou 3 blocs en pied de page. Bientôt une bêta. 3 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 20 juin 2019 ZwiiCMS 9.1.13 est sortie, déjà !!! Deux erreurs signalées par @Oyate ## Version 9.1.13 - Corrections : - Erreur du sitemap.xml lorsqu'un blog ne contient pas d'article. - OpenGraph : erreur lors de la suppression de l'imagette si absente. 1 2 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 12 juillet 2019 ZwiiCMS 9.2 est en ligne - Nouveautés : - Module de recherche dans le pied de page - Mentions légales dans le pied de page - Les pages "Recherche" et "Plan du site" peuvent être appelées à partir de TinyMCE dans le menu lien. - le gabarit du pied de page peut se paramétrer en colonnes et en lignes, de 1 à 3 blocs. - Gabarit de page, présentation asymétrique des barres latérales : 33% - 50% - 16% et inversement - Améliorations : - Gestion des sous-menus : suppression de l'option de masquage des pages dans le menu horizontal - Remise à plat et homogénéisation des masques d'édition des pages, footer et header - TinyMCE la fenêtre lien propose le sitemap et le module de recherche - Correction : - Menu : alignement avec le contenu, couleur de l'arrière-plan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 15 juillet 2019 ZwiiCMS 9.2.01 est en ligne Suite à des remontées d'erreur publiées par @Gilux , un correctif est en ligne. Cette mise à jour est recommandée, non pas pour des problèmes de sécurité mais pour que la sauvegarde de thème soit pleinement opérationnelle. Au programme : la sauvegarde du thème prend en compte custom.css libellés incorrects dans l'édition de page (parre pour barre, vive le remplacer de masse) marges autour du footer lorsque hors du site. Cette modification entraîne d'autres correctifs : dont la suppression d'une marge d'1 px, un nom de division erronée quand le footer est hors du site ; une amélioration du css pour les marges verticales du footer, les marges verticales acceptent une valeur nulle (pour les images). lors de la modification du texte personnalisé dans l'éditeur Tinymce, l'aperçu est affiché dans le pied de page dynamiquement, ce n'était plus le cas avec sa transformation en éditeur enrichi. 1 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 18 juillet 2019 ZwiiCMS 9.2.02 est en ligne Amélioration de la procédure d'autoupdate : warning en cas d'erreur de suppression de fichiers précédents. livraison d'un nouvel htaccess avec des fins de ligne LF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 5 août 2019 ZwiiCMS 9.2.03 est en ligne suite à la remontée d'erreurs signalées par @Gilux au niveau des sous-menu du menu placé en-dehors du site. De même, un problème a été corrigé sur l'affichage du module news lorsque les nouvelles sont sur plusieurs pages dans un gabarit de page. Cette correction a nécessité de réécrire une partie du code de main.php Le change.log : ## Version 9.2.03 - Corrections : - Menu fixe en dehors du site : - overlay du sous-menu activé au-dessus de la page - impossibilité de sélectionner un élément sous un sous-menu - Modules : les modes de gestion s'affichent en pleine page - réécriture du code. - Syntaxe du fichier main.php A partir d'aujourd'hui il n'y a plus de support de mise à jour automatisée à partir d'une version 8 vers une vers une version 9. Avec l'été, le développement de Zwii est en pause. La gestion multilangue n'a pas avancée car il est nécessaire de renforcer le stockage des données, ce sera l'objet de la prochaine version. Par la même occasion, il faudra un php 7.0 mini pour faire tourner ZwiiCMS ! Le support de jqueryui en version 9.5 et la gestion multilangue dans la version 10, en tout cas c'est le projet. 1 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 15 août 2019 Encore une mise à jour mineure 9.2.04. - Correction : - Conserver htaccess dans le dossier temp lors du nettoyage - Suppression : - Swiper C'est un peu con mais depuis très longtemps, le htaccess du dossier temp était effacé à chaque nettoyage du dossier. Le fichier de sécurité est maintenant exclu du nettoyage. Swiper ne fait plus partie de la distribution standard après la constatation d'erreurs dans son code et de lenteurs au chargement. Il n'aurait d'ailleurs jamais dû être intégré. Pour les fans, il est possible de le réinstaller facilement, le dossier n'est pas supprimé, il suffit d'ajouter cette ligne dans core : En cas de suppression, le contenu du dossier swiper à insérer dans core/vendor est en ci-dessous. Si j'arrive à mettre la main sur un slider facile à mettre en œuvre, je le proposerai en remplacement. swiper.zip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 15 août 2019 Précisions : Le template Swiper étant encore présent dans TinyMCE (merci @Gilux pour le "signalement"), je l'ai supprimé de la configuration. Cependant, le template sera toujours présent dans les dossiers de TinyMCE, en effet, l'installateur de la mise à jour n'efface pas de fichiers. De même, le dossier swiper sera toujours présent dans core/vendor à vous de le supprimer. On ne change pas de version, pour réaliser la mise à jour si elle a déjà été faite, il suffit de la "forcer" : La version 9.2.05 à sortir supprimera le template et le dossier swiper pour toutes les versions inférieures. Cela signifie que si vous le réinstallez, il sera persistant.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 17 août 2019 9.2.05 est en ligne. Le dossier de Swiper ainsi que le template dans TinyMCE sont effacés.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 19 septembre 2019 9.2.06 est en ligne. Deux correctifs sont publiés après signalement par @Marie-Anne et par @APOA : Validation html, balise de fermeture div non générée lorsque le footer est dans le site. Syntaxe de robots.txt, autoriser le parcours de /core/, /module/, de /site/ sauf /site/data/ 2 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 27 septembre 2019 9.2.07 en ligne Détails des modifications : Désormais le placement des modules est possible quelque soit sa nature. Seule exception : la redirection. Les modules créés par les membres seront donc aussi positionnables librement. Le code d'insertion de la position libre est modifié pour plus de lisibilité. [] est remplacé par [MODULE] ou [MENU] selon qu'il s'agisse d'un module ou d'un menu de barre latérale. Les anciennes balises d'insertion libres [] sont toujours acceptées, tout comme un code d'insertion en minuscules [module] ou [menu] Enfin <object> est admis dans le calcul dynamique du ratio hauteur / largeur de l'objet (core.js.php) 2 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 2 octobre 2019 [9.2.08] Dispo ce soir. Grosse correction d'un bug empêchant l'accès au paramètres d'un module après un changement de gabarit de page, bug relevé par @sylvainlelievre. Autre correction, la non livraison du fichier core.js.php dans la version précédente avec la prise en charge de la balise object dans le recalcul de la proportion de taille de l'élément, problème relevé par @Gilux Enfin une modification des libellés de fichier d'aide après le changement des codes d'insertion des modules de la 9.2.07 1 3 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 5 octobre 2019 Après la mise à jour vers la 9.2.08, vous aurez un dossier en trop avec les modules. Ce dossier qui se nomme module est à supprimer "à la main". Pas d'incidence sur le fonctionnement du CMS. Merci à la vigilance de @Gilux 1 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 8 octobre 2019 9.2.09 en ligne le 6/10 Cette mise à jour corrige un bug très particulier. En modifiant une page, l'aperçu était dupliqué dans le texte personnalisé du footer. C'est pourtant n vieux bug qui a été signalé deux fois dans la même journée par deux membres, @APOA et @Seb L'aperçu dans le footer lors de la modification du texte personnalisé est donc désactivé. Bug découvert à la création du module Sondage basé sur Form. A la première utilisation d'un formulaire, un warning s'affiche, il se trouve qu'une partie du schéma de donnée n'était pas déclaré initialement. 1 2 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 19 novembre 2019 9.2.10 est en ligne. Dernière version de la branche 9 avant la publication de la version 10. Modifications préparatoires à la v10 : core.json conserve une trace du dossier d'installation, cette information pourra être exploitée en cas d'import dans une v10 installée dans un autre dossier ce qui permettra de corriger les liens des URL. C'est donc une information destinée à une migration. Modification interne des clés du module gallery. Les légendes sont stockées dans une clé qui correspond au nom du fichier avec son extension. Le point séparateur entrait en conflit avec la classe de stockage utilisée dans la V10. le point est donc supprimé sur toutes les clés. Cette opération s'effectue en une fois après la mise à jour. Modifications : Le thème bénéficie de modifications et d'optimisations, le script précédent étant très loin d'être à la hauteur des attentes. La hauteur de la bannière est réellement responsive lorsque la largeur de l'écran diminue. Option de dimension minimale de hauteur de bannière en fonction de la taille réelle de la bannière, hauteur dynamique limitée. Les dimensions de la bannière sont affichées, ce qui permet de vérifier si elles collent à celles du site. L'aperçu dans le pied de page est réactivée. Corrections : La hauteur responsive de la bannière empêchait de la rendre cliquable. Responsive File Manager : extraction d'archive zip affichant un warning et ne s'effectuant pas. Code Mirror affichant des warning dans les logs : ajout de modules optionnels. 1 4 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 24 novembre 2019 9.2.11 en ligne ## version 9.2.11 - Corrections : - Marge du pied de page par défaut 5px - Installation sans site exemple : suppression des barres latérales - Edition de page : - Affichage de l'option Fil d'ariane alors que le titre est masqué. - Page parente, l'option "ne pas afficher les pages enfants dans le menu horizontal" est incompatible avec une page désactivée : désactivation et masquage lorsque la page est désactivée. - Mauvais encodage des titres de pages perturbant l'affichage des caractères spéciaux ( ex: apostrophes ). - Modifications : - Recherche d'une mise à jour en ligne, s'effectue une fois par jour et devient optionnelle. - Amélioration de l'écran d'édition des pages. - iframe responsive 1 1 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 29 novembre 2019 ZwiCMS 9.2.12 La v9 est un terrain de jeu idéal pour sortir rapidement les nouveautés en attendant le v10. Au programme : ## version 9.2.12 - Modifications - TinyMCE : - Ajout d'un template effet accordéon. - Supprimer le filtrage des éléments. - Supprimer le forçage de l'affichage des médias à 100% - Activer le dimensionnement des médias - Module Form : - Etiquette de séparation - Checkbox retourne un astérisque plutôt que 1 - Thème - Menu : - Couleur de fond de la page sélectionnée - Effet bord arrondi, page sélectionnée TinyMCE sera moins sévère avec les attributs html. Désormais les vidéos sont affichées en mode édition dans leur taille réelle, ce qui facilite la mise en page, la modification de la taille est aussi activée dans la fenêtre d'édition. Un nouvel effet Accordéon fait son apparition dans les gabarits. Pour ajouter des nouveaux éléments, code source obligatoire, le fonctionnement est aisé à comprendre. Le module Form dispose d'un nouvel objet Etiquette que l'on peut placer où l'on veut dans le formulaire, idéal pour une mise en page de qualité. Toujours dans Form, les champs checkbox sélectionnées étaient identifiés par 1 au lieu de true dans le mail envoyé ou dans l'export au format csv. Désormais ce sera un astérisque, un info plus parlante. Enfin le thème de menu dispose de deux nouvelles options : La couleur de fond du menu de la page sélectionnée peut être personnalisée par exemple avec la couleur de fond de page pour faire un effet "classeur" On peut ajouter des bords arrondis à cette même sélection dans le menu. Je remercie @zin90 et @Sourigo et les autres membres qui ont fait émerger des idées et servent ainsi l'évolution du CMS. 1 1 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 5 décembre 2019 ZwiiCMS 9.2.13 est libre. Au programme des bugs et quelques améliorations : ## version 9.2.13 - Corrections : - Gestionnaire de fichiers, modifications des paramètres des miniatures. - Filtrage du nom des pages dans la fenêtre d'édition des pages. - Format de date dans le module Blog - Module Form : - correction des options de champ pour le type étiquette - Modifications : - Suppression d'options inutiles dans l'édition d'une page de type de barre latérale. - Module Form : - édition : champs d’options condensés - édition : ordre des champs dans le sélecteur 3 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 6 décembre 2019 ZwiiCMS 9.2.14 Une sortie rapide pour livrer une version actualisée du script du gestionnaire de fichier (merci à @Gilux pour l'info). Le thème bénéficie de petites corrections : Aérer la présentation des masques lorsque la largeur du site est étroite. Ajout d'un contrôle de cohérence lors de l'import d'un thèmes généré par une version 9.1 ## version 9.2.14 - Mise à jour : - Script d'upload du gestionnaire de fichiers - Modifications : - Thème : optimisation des masques de saisie pour le site en largeur 750px. - Corrections : - Thème : gestion d'erreur lors de l'import d'un thème issu d'une version inférieure. 3 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 11 décembre 2019 ZwiiCMS 9.2.15 La dernière version de la branche 9 est publiée. Correction de bugs : Une énorme correction au niveau de la sauvegarde des données. L'algorithme de la fonction Savedata pouvant occasionner l'enregistrement de données de module dans theme.json et vice versa. Ce problème est donc corrigé, les données sont désormais dans le bon fichier. Cette correction est complètement nécessaire avant de prétendre passer à la version 10. Je vais d'ailleurs empêcher tout mise à jour lorsque le numéro de version de la version installée n'est pas correct. La couleur du titre dans le menu burger est conforme à celle du menu en nom à celle des titres. L'effet de couleur de fond personnalisée d'une page sélectionnée dans le menu est limité aux pages parents. Trucs mieux : Lorsqu'une page est affichée dans une popup intégrée (lity), seul le contenu de la page est présenté, donc sans bannière, menu etc.. L'effet accordéon permet de fermer tous les accordéons ouverts, précédemment il en restait un toujours ouvert. Le titre de site qui fait son apparition dans le menu burger, nouvelle option de menu qui existait dans l'ex v11, désormais dans la v9 et la v10 - Corrections : - Sauvegarde des données de site. - Couleur du titre de site dans le menu réduit. - Améliorations : - Affichage du contenu seul d'une page du site dans une popup Lity sans menu, bannière et pied de page. - Editeur de texte ; effet accordéon, les accordéons peuvent être tous refermés. - Thème ; menu : lorsque le menu est réduit, le titre du site peut être inséré à la gauche du menu burger. 2 2 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 23 décembre 2019 ZwiiCMS 9.2.16 Mise à jour vivement recommandée : corrige un problème, un oubli plutôt dans la procédure d'update qui ne mettait pas à jour le numéro de version. améliore significativement la copie de sauvegarde qui sera compatible avec la prochaine v10 modifie la baseUrl stockée afin de transmettre la donnée relative à la réécriture d'url, information utilisée dans la procédure de conversion lors de la restauration sur un autre site / dossier. ## version 9.2.16 - Optimisation : - Sauvegarde manuelle des données de site (dossiers file et data). - Modification : - Stocke la réécriture d'url dans baseUrl en cas de changement d'arborescence lors d'un transfert de site. - Correction : - Problème lors de la mise à jour de la variable dataVersion. 1 Partager ce message Lien à poster Partager sur d’autres sites
Fred 1 575 Signaler ce message Posté(e) 8 janvier 2020 ZwiiCMS v9.2.17 Une correction mineure est déployée ce soir, elle corrige une erreur dans la fil d'ariane qui affichait l'id de la page parente et non son titre. Merci à @Sourigo pour le signalement. 1 2 Partager ce message Lien à poster Partager sur d’autres sites